Abstract

The invention discloses a double-layer lining-free down-proof fabric which comprises down filling tubes composed of upper weaves and lower weaves, and a single-layer transition weave formed by weaving the upper weaves and the lower weaves between two adjacent down filling tubes, wherein the upper weaves are formed by interweaving upper warps and upper wefts; the lower weaves are formed by interweaving lower warps and lower wefts; the single-layer transition weave is formed by interweaving the upper warps, the lower warps and the woven transition wefts. The double-layer lining-free down-proof fabric of the invention has a better down-proof effect, and solves problems that a down-proof fabric woven by a surface-inner layer exchanging technology in the prior art is easy to produce gaps and cause down leakage at layer exchanging positions; down jackets made of the down-proof fabric of the invention are free of down leakage and have a better warm retention effect.

Background technology
Lightweight constantly pursued by down jackets, has driven feather dress fabric and the development of down jackets manufacturing technology, and lightweight down jackets are not in use by gallbladder cloth (bag flannelette) but direct fabric wraps up eider down, and such feather dress fabric is called non-lining down-proof fabric. Current this non-lining down-proof fabric is commonly used, but filling floss in the down jackets course of processing between two shell fabrics is a troublesome job, easily causes the skewness of eider down on the one hand, is that the pin hole of fare part easily runs floss on the other hand. For this problem, production occurs in that double-deck non-lining down-proof fabric. Double-deck non-lining down-proof fabric product adopts double-layered structure, uniformly and avoids pin hole easily to run the problem of floss to fill floss convenience, is designed to double layered tubular fabric. Initial double-deck non-lining down-proof fabric is designed to simple the exterior and the interior exchangeable cloth, only carries out changing layer at warp-wise, is open into tubing, and floss can be filled in the inside; Certainly also broadwise can changing layer, form vertical tube shape, after filling floss ready-made clothes because of vertical tube shape, floss can fall to assembling, less in actual production.
The many purposes reaching anti-chiseling down through press polish of general anti-velvet fabric, and the production difficult point of bilayer non-lining down-proof fabric is, process because press polish can not be done after dyeing, so Density is sufficiently high, the low elastic polyester filament bilayer DOWNPROOF FABRIC of such as 50D, its end count is 1470/10 centimetres, and filling density is 1420/10 centimetres, must use weight pound loom processing when weaving. But changing layer place up and down after upper machine, because of upper and lower layer warp thread staggered after changing layer so that interweaving-resistance is too big and breaks not bright pick yarn, can change one thin gap of formation, layer place, having Lou floss phenomenon after filling floss to occur, eider down is easy to run out of from these gaps herein. For solving this problem in production, one way is to go to fill out this space with several (amounting to 8 before and after layer as changed) thicker weft yarns, but cure the symptoms, not the disease before and after layer changing, and effect is undesirable, and easily cause upper weft thread uneven fineness, affect the regularity of cloth cover. Renewal by equipment later improves, adopt the loom with let-off take-up stop function, several latitudes after changing layer stop volume and stop sending, increase local filling density, achieve certain effect, but the existing loom of most enterprises does not have let-off take-up stop function at present, adopts and will change new equipment in this way, renewal of the equipment cost is high, the cycle is long, is unfavorable for promoting the use of.
Summary of the invention
Present invention seek to address that the existing woven anti-velvet fabric of employing the exterior and the interior exchanged form because interweaving-resistance is big, beat not bright pick yarn and produce grin and cause the technical problem of race floss.
For solving above-mentioned technical problem, the present invention adopts the following technical scheme that
A kind of double-deck non-lining down-proof fabric of design, including the down filling pipe being made up of umbrella organisations and lower-hierarchy, and knits, by described umbrella organisations and lower-hierarchy, the monolayer transition tissue being connected together and formed between adjacent two down filling pipe; Described umbrella organisations is interwoven by top line and upper layer weft yarns, and described lower-hierarchy is formed by lower layer warp yarns and lower floor's weft yarns, and described monolayer transition tissue is formed by described top line, lower layer warp yarns and the transition weft yarns inweaved.
Preferably, the width of described down filling pipe is equal.
Preferably, described down filling pipe is placed equidistant.
Preferably, the transition weft yarn inweaved in described monolayer transition tissue is 6~20.
Preferably, described down filling pipe includes for filling the wide pipe of floss and the tubule for transition, described tubule is arranged between adjacent two wide pipes, being knitted by described monolayer transition tissue between described tubule and the wide pipe of its both sides and be connected together, the transition weft yarn inweaved in described monolayer transition tissue is at least two.
Preferably, the width of described tubule is 2~6mm.
Preferably, the thread density in described monolayer transition tissue is the twice of thread density in described umbrella organisations or lower-hierarchy.
Preferably, described monolayer transition tissue is plain weave.
The beneficial effects of the present invention is:
1. the present invention takes to weave the mode of monolayer transition tissue between levels tissue, do not carry out the exterior and the interior exchange, the exterior and the interior can be overcome in two when changing layer, to beat the phenomenon of not bright pick yarn: warp thread need not levels exchange on the one hand, flexing degree is obviously reduced, warp and weft interweaving resistance is also greatly reduced, and makes easily to draw close between weft yarn; Being become single layer of woven at transition tissue place from bilayer on the other hand, monolayer filling density is the twice of double-deck filling density, arranges more tight, further eliminate the original condition producing grin between weft yarn. Effect by the two aspect, it is possible to be inherently eliminated the phenomenon that gap occurs between weft yarn when changing layer, achieve desirable effect through test weaving.
2. the anti-race floss better effects if of bilayer non-lining down-proof fabric of the present invention, overcome and prior art adopts the layer place that change that the exterior and the interior changes the woven anti-velvet fabric existence of layer technology easily produce gap, cause the difficult problem running floss, adopting the down jackets that the anti-velvet fabric of the present invention makes to be absent from running floss problem, warming effect is better.
3. bilayer non-lining down-proof fabric of the present invention weaving cost is low, does not need to change the novel fabric manufacture equipment with let-off take-up stop function and can realize producing, it is easy to high-volume is promoted.

The present invention is when organization design, and the transition weft yarn quantity inweaved in the monolayer transition tissue between down filling pipe can set according to demand. In embodiment 1, down filling pipe width is identical and equidistantly evenly distributed, with monolayer transition tissue interval between each down filling pipe, different with weft yarn arrangement density according to weft threads density, has inweaved the monolayer plain weave transition weft yarn of 6~20 between two down filling pipe.
In example 2, down filling pipe has been set as two kinds that width is different, wide pipe is used for filling floss, tubule is used for transition, adopt monolayer transition tissue to knit between tubule and wide pipe to connect, the structure so arranged, make the monolayer transition tissue between wide pipe and tubule only need to inweave a small amount of (minimum reduce to two) transition weft yarn can realize wide pipe and connect with knitting of tubule, so can save the quantity of the transition weft yarn inweaved, but without influence on quality and the anti-race floss performance of fabric, simultaneously can also sets itself monolayer plain weave fill yarn ends as required.
The woven double-deck non-lining down-proof fabric of existing employing the exterior and the interior switching technology, its exterior and the interior changes the tissue morphology figure at layer place as shown in Figure 4, and upper and lower layer warp thread therein and upper and lower layer weft yarn have exchanged respectively. top line a, b and upper layer weft yarns 1.-be 4. made into upper strata fabric, lower layer warp yarns A, B and lower floor's weft yarn I-IV are made into lower floor's fabric, then the exterior and the interior exchange is carried out between upper strata fabric and lower floor's fabric, in next down filling pipe, levels fabric have exchanged position, result in formation of two adjacent down filling pipe, and carry out changing the position of layer at levels fabric, owing to warp thread interweaving-resistance when levels exchanges is very big, the weft yarn introduced easily produces backwash, namely change after layer because of upper, lower floor interlocks, cause interweaving-resistance too big and break not bright pick yarn, a thin gap can be formed, produce grin, after filling floss, eider down is just easy to run out of from these gaps.The present invention adopts the pin hole that double layered tubular fabric solves fare part easily to run floss problem, also fills floss convenient simultaneously, fills floss amount easy to control, it is ensured that eider down is evenly distributed; Also solving face-back-changing weave simultaneously and produce a difficult problem for grin, anti-race floss better effects if when the exterior and the interior exchange because breaking not bright pick yarn, while improve product quality, also reduce production cost, technology is simple, is conducive to the raising performance of enterprises.
